I went to Riverside Baptist School for 7-9th grade in the 1970's.  They did not have a cafeteria, so we had to bring our lunch.  Nothing was better than not having anything to make a lunch in the house and having your parents give you money to go to Whiteway's Deli across the street.  It was my first introduction to a deli.  Sometimes we'd run over there before the school bus left and buy Mentos.  At that time you couldn't get them anywhere else.
